Output 4335af0a2332984953f2b6a606fe8bd52f038a54209c53eefd105aae7487cf23:1

value
37097264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bcfecab6913f03cfe58c41040c152e5c895c87b OP_EQUAL
address
3Jp5NGChFXL6WvuHVuJn7q1ZbSkHRW1j2N
transaction
4335af0a2332984953f2b6a606fe8bd52f038a54209c53eefd105aae7487cf23
spent
true